Bishop William J. Justice, retired Auxiliary Bishop of the Archdiocese of San Francisco, former Board of Trustees member, and alumnus of St. Patrick’s, returned to the Seminary to celebrate the Rite of Admission to Candidacy on February 21, 2018.  Nine of our Theology III seminarians were formally recognized as candidates for Holy Orders.  These candidates come from the Diocese of Honolulu, the Diocese of Sacramento, the Archdiocese of San Francisco, and the Diocese of Stockton.  During his homily, Bishop Justice spoke about Job’s refusal to go to Nineveh to proclaim God’s message and congratulated the men for their discernment and their obedience in freely responding to God’s call.  Also present were Bishop Clarence Silva of the Diocese of Honolulu and Bishop Jaime Soto of the Diocese of Sacramento, along with the vocation directors of the dioceses and STPSU faculty members.
